New England Revolution 2008 Home Kit
With a name like “Revolution”, the New England kit should be patriotic. However, on the home shirt, primarily blue, the red color on the front and back of the sleeves does not really belong. The club crest, on the left chest, should be patriotic enough for fans, as should the “REVOLUTION” name on the shirt. The grayish accents on the bottom of the shirt would look just fine if the red parts were blue, like the rest of the shirt. Overall, this shirt is too busy for me.

New England Revolution 2008 Away Kit
The away shirt is better, but only just. The same accents are on this shirt, but instead it’s dark blue on the sleeves and red on the sides. Again, this is just a way to get all three colors of the American flag on a shirt, but if the old US National Team kits are anything to go by, sometimes it’s best to not have all three of our colors on a shirt because they just don’t go well together. However, the flag-imitating club crest looks just fine.
